Snooker 3D: Mastering the cue
To learn how to play Snooker 3D, drag your mouse or finger to aim across the green felt. Pull back to set your power levels before letting go to strike. Just watch out for the spin on the cue ball. A common mistake is hitting everything at max power, which ruins your accuracy.
Snooker 3D controls and rules
Your Snooker 3D controls rely on your ability to judge distance and angle. You must pocket the red balls first, then cycle through the colors to run up your score. Don't be surprised when the physics feel a bit floaty during long shots; it takes a few tries to find the right touch.
